version
whzbox version prints the build metadata embedded in the current binary.
Syntax
whzbox version
whzbox --version
Arguments
This command takes no positional arguments.
Flags
This command uses only the global flags.
Behavior
- Prints the version string assembled from the embedded
Version,Commit, andBuildTimevalues. - Uses a lightweight app path that does not initialize the state store or network adapters.
- Binaries built directly from source without linker flags report the fallback values
dev,none, andunknown. - GoReleaser snapshot builds embed
v0.0.0-devplus the current commit and build timestamp. - Tagged GoReleaser release builds embed the Git tag version plus the corresponding commit and build timestamp.
Output
The output format is:
whzbox <version> (<commit>) built <build-time>
When the binary is built without linker flags, the default values are:
- version:
dev - commit:
none - build time:
unknown
